Duluth, MN vs Santa Cruz, CA
Cost of Living Comparison
Duluth, MN is more affordable by 21.1 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Duluth, MN | Santa Cruz, CA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 88.8 | 109.9 | -21.1 |
| Housing | 71.1 | 164.3 | -93.2 |
| Goods | 95.3 | 105.2 | -9.9 |
| Utilities | 87.3 | 152.7 | -65.5 |
| Other Services | 92.2 | 100.3 | -8.1 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Duluth, MN | Santa Cruz, CA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$67,612 | $104,409 |
| Median Home Value | $193,600 | $951,300 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$909 | $2,094 |
| Per Capita Income | $37,319 | $52,887 |
